Output 89d80f2e299ec5c78b9a80a900cbc4cd87d7430b599438346cf62ab9d797c9fe:0

value
8789362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
89d80f2e299ec5c78b9a80a900cbc4cd87d7430b599438346cf62ab9d797c9fe
spent
true